This is a mechanical clean-up of the way *.c files include
system header files.

(1) sources under compat/, platform sha-1 implementations, and
xdelta code are exempt from the following rules;

(2) the first #include must be "git-compat-util.h" or one of
our own header file that includes it first (e.g. config.h,
builtin.h, pkt-line.h);

(3) system headers that are included in "git-compat-util.h"
need not be included in individual C source files.

(4) "git-compat-util.h" does not have to include subsystem
specific header files (e.g. expat.h).
